Original Description
Fitz Hugh Lane’s Baltimore Harbor (1850) captures the serene yet industrious spirit of mid-19th-century maritime America with luminous precision. The painting bathes the harbor in golden sunlight, where sailing ships and steamboats coexist—a tranquil scene animated by delicate reflections on the water. A master of Luminism, Lane employs meticulous detail, smooth brushwork, and a radiant palette to create a harmonious balance between nature and human activity. This work exemplifies his role in defining American Luminism, a movement emphasizing stillness, light, and atmospheric effects. Historically, Lane’s harbor scenes document the era’s economic vitality and technological transition, making them invaluable to both art history and cultural studies. Baltimore Harbor stands as a testament to his ability to transform ordinary moments into poetic visual narratives.
